First and foremost let me start with a short review of the Nagesh Kuknoor super-awesome children music travel saga Dhanak! Dhanak is story of two very sweet and direct  kids Chhotu and Pari, who embark on a tour in search of Great King Shahrukh Khan ji so that he can help return Chhotu's eyesight. Along the way they meet a cast of colorful characters. The backdrop of rural Rajasthan is as much a character. These 2 children give a heart-melting performance to make this the breakout film of the season. 5 stars from me.
